Indie Semiconductor Insider Trading

Some recent studies suggest that insider trading raises the cost of capital for securities issuers and decreases overall economic growth. Trading by specific Indie Semiconductor insiders, such as employees or executives, is commonly permitted as long as it does not rely on Indie Semiconductor's material information that is not in the public domain. Local jurisdictions usually require such trading to be reported in order to monitor insider transactions. In many U.S. states, trading conducted by corporate officers, key employees, directors, or significant shareholders must be reported to the regulator or publicly disclosed, usually within a few business days of the trade. In these cases, Indie Semiconductor insiders must file a Form 4 with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) when buying or selling shares of their own companies.

indie Semiconductor, Inc. provides automotive semiconductors and software solutions for advanced driver assistance systems, connected car, user experience, and electrification applications. The company was incorporated in 2007 and is headquartered in Aliso Viejo, California. Indie Semiconductor operates under Semiconductor Equipment Materials classification in the United States and is traded on NASDAQ Exchange. It employs 400 people.
